You have placed some JQuery function in a WordPress post but it does nothing. Yet you know the code is correct. This is the way of getting it to work.
In this example I want to change the text contained in a div tag, plus I am taking into consideration that jQuery has already loaded/included.
<div id="change" style="background-color: blue;">Blue div box</div>
<script language="JavaScript" type="text/javascript">
jQuery(document).ready(function(){
$j=jQuery.noConflict();
$j("#change").html("My text has changed!");
});
</script>
